IV. Sequence of Operations
As operator, you are responsible that no one is in harm's way whilst you are
operating the transporter.
Connecting the PTT3 to a Trailer
Ensure the coupling between the PTT3 and the trailer is properly connected.
When the lift is performed, do not lift higher than necessary as it puts additional strain on the
lift cylinder.
The casters at the back of the PTT3 will lift from 1.5" from the floor. This applies the load to the drive
wheel for easy maneuverability.
The coupling must be attached vertically so the casters in the back of the PTT3 are in the air when it
has been connected to the trailer.
If the trailer is fixed to the PTT3, the casters can be removed to avoid becoming stuck on
uneven floors.

The direction and speed of the PTT3 is controlled and adjusted by the accelerator at the top of the
handle.
A safety switch is located on the handle. When triggered, the PTT3 will stop and take a small leap
forward to prevent the pinning of the operator.
